From 1982 to 1992 North Samaria's economy grew at an annual rate of 3.5%,but from 1992 to 2002 North Samaria's economy grew by only 1% per year.In 1992 Samaria's per capita income was $8000.How much higher would North Samaria's per capita income have been in 2002 if growth from 1992 to 2002 had been 3.5% rather than 1%?


A) $2241
B) $2448
C) $2508
D) $3285
